Behind the Shadows

Unforgiving Fish

Will burst out laughing after Sapphire had explained what had happened. Lottie looked like she might throw up. Sapphire was now back on her pegasus and they were all back on track with flying aimlessly through the air. This time however they had a direction to fly aimlessly in. The weird creature had not mentioned Clarisse though so looking for her would be a little bit difficult. The sun was blazing down on the three of them and it was not a pleasant experience.
"There a small village on the coastline over there" Lottie points out and nods in the direction in front of them. Will scrunches his nose and sighs.
"I don't like villages. Everyone always seems to know everyone and their dog" Will mutters. Sapphire chuckles and silently agrees. She had passed through a few villages when she was on the run with Luke, Annabeth and Thalia. As soon as she arrived everyone was talking about them and then the rumours started. They left the next morning with their non existent flees.
"Its the only place with people for miles. We have to try" Lottie tries her best to motivate them.
When they arrive there is no one in sight and the area is so quiet a pin could be heard dropping. Sapphire half expected a tumbleweed to go past them like in the old western movies she had seen.
"Well this is exciting!" Sapphire says sarcasticly and Will snorts. Lottie strolls on ahead ignoring them. Sapphire grabs her backpack and pulls out the photo she had packed. Hopefully they would come across some sort of living soul. The village was just a few wooden cabins, a little fountain and a fishing area. Lottie goes over to the fountain to fill up her water bottle. Sapphire cringes at her, but she keeps her mouth shut.
"HELLO!" Will calls out and is answered with silence. "Fantastic"
"It looks like the place is completely deserted" Sapphire states as she steps up next to him. Lottie stands up from the fountain and looks around. "I wish I had made some missing person posters to pin up. Annoying missing person. Comes to Toolbox and Spanner" Sapphire giggles at herself and the other join in.

"Strangers are not welcome here" A croaky voice booms over their laughter. Sapphire and the others go silents and turn towards the voice. It's a little old woman in and she is holding a large fish in her hands. Doe she intend to hit them with it? That would be a first.
"We mean no harm" Will pipes up with his charming smile and soft words. Now there was something Sapphire could never achieve at. She always did find that part of being a child of Apollo the most tiresome. It was like they had be as bright as the sun and Sapphire was dark side of the moon. The old woman scoffs and glares at them. It looks like she would not be falling for charm.
"Great fishing spot you have here" Lottie chirps. It was her turn to try her charm. The old woman growls and throws her fish at Sapphire. It hits her square in the face. Sapphire falls back a step and catches the fish in her hands.
"Do you intend to steal our fish, little girl?" The old woman barks at Lottie. Considering that Lottie was the daughter of Hermes it would not surprise Sapphire. Luke had once stolen Sapphires left shoe and hair ties just because he could.
"N-no. I would never -" Lottie scrambles back and hides behind Sapphire. Still holding the fish Sapphire looks it over and frowns.
"Why is the fish the colour?" Sapphire asks. The old woman shrugs and avoids eye contact "Poison is a cruel method"Sapphire raises her eyebrows at the woman.
"Dogs are used to catch them" Liar. "Poison is never used to catch them"
"I know it's poison" Sapphire sighs in annoyance. She could sense the pain this fish had been in before dying. Sapphire could feel suffering in the water near the village. "Do you know what it feels like to die from poison?" The old woman shakes her head and hangs her head slightly. "You have the equipment to fish properly so why use poison?"
"The ocean nearly took little Meg's life" The old woman coughs out "He has to pay"
"Who?"
"That's none of your business" The old woman has gotten out another fish and Sapphire takes a step back.
"It would be a good idea to tell us" Sapphire is beginning to lose her patience and it is showing. The fountain bubbles slightly. Will clears his throat and nudges Sapphire. She nods at him to tell him that she already sees it. "The ocean can be an unforgiving place for those who threaten it"
"You kids would not understand our ways"
"Try us" Will pipes in "you would be surprised the amount of stuff we can understand"
"The god of the sea. He did it. He has always been cruel to our village. The waters flood our lands and take our children" The woman explains and spits bitterly at the ground.
"Ah. Well that changes things" Sapphire mutters out. "I can help. Let me clean the water and contact someone and you can help us out too" She smirks at the old woman and wanders over to the ocean line. These people do not deserve such cruelty. Let them live well and happy and they shall not bother you, Poseidon. Sapphire goes over the message again and again in her head to get it across to Poseidon. She also chucks a drachma into the water as a little payment offer. It never felt this awkward with contacting Apollo, but with Poseidon it felt like Sapphire was contacting some distant relative. The water swirls slightly and She takes that as a good sign. Spreading her arms out and picture the ocean as clean and healthy, hoping that She was doing it right. In a matter of minutes the dark deadly water starts to clear and the sapphire blue starts to show through the darkness.
"Now its your turn to help us out" Sapphire states as she approaches the old woman with the picture of Jake in hand. "Have you seen this boy?" When the woman sees the picture she goes a little white.
"He was taken to the grey cave in the woods" The woman replies. The name of the place did not sit well with Sapphire.
"Where are these woods?" The woman points past the village.
"Just over the hill. He was taken few days ago. He came here in an unstable state and was raving about some girl. Then these people came and snatched him away just hours after his arrival" Sapphire nods as she listens.

"Thank you" She smiles at the old woman "Poseidon won't be a bother for now on and please don't punish the fish for his temper" The old woman nods and drops the fish she is holding. Sapphire makes her way towards their hidden Pegasuses. This was the best lead they had had so far. Lottie and Will both look chuffed as they climb onto their pegasus. Sapphire could not blame them. She just proved the charm and smiles were not always the way to go about things. Sometimes playing dirty go you places. Sapphire was no angel.
